What Drives Market Cap

Several key factors drive changes in market capitalization for the top 10 cryptocurrencies. Technological advancements, such as upgrades to a blockchain network, can enhance a cryptocurrency's utility and attract more investors, thereby increasing its market cap. Regulatory news, both positive and negative, can also have a profound impact. For example, favorable regulations can boost investor confidence and drive up market caps, while restrictive policies can have the opposite effect. Additionally, market sentiment, driven by news cycles and social media trends, plays a crucial role. Blockchain Asset Evaluation

Evaluating blockchain assets involves assessing various metrics, including market cap, trading volume, and price trends. For instance, a cryptocurrency with a high market cap but low trading volume may indicate limited liquidity and potential price manipulation risks. Conversely, a cryptocurrency with a growing market cap and increasing trading volume may signal strong investor interest and potential for future growth. What is market capitalization according to MarketCap?

Market capitalization, as defined by MarketCap, is the total value of a cryptocurrency calculated by multiplying its current price by the total circulating supply. It is a key metric used to rank cryptocurrencies and assess their relative size in the market.

What is the difference between market capitalization and fully diluted market cap on MarketCap?

The difference between market capitalization and fully diluted market cap on MarketCap is that market capitalization is calculated using the current circulating supply, while fully diluted market cap takes into account the maximum supply of a cryptocurrency, including coins that are not yet in circulation.
